Introduction: Powdered activated carbon decolorization depends on liquid chemistry, Get hold of conduct, and separation situations, not on 1 specification variety by itself.
A specification learner may see iodine worth, surface region, methylene blue worth, pH assortment, particle dimension, and temperature selection with a powdered activated carbon supplier web site and expect them to predict the ultimate coloration result. In genuine liquid decolorization, People values are practical signals, but they do not act just like a common effectiveness formulation. precisely the same decolorization activated carbon can behave in another way if the pigment chemistry, solvent or h2o matrix, pH, temperature, mixing depth, Call time, and filtration stage improve. this short article clarifies that issue ladder so viewers can interpret decolorization activated carbon provider and activated carbon producer web pages with better technical caution.
one adsorption selection describes carbon inclination, not the total liquid decolorization consequence
Adsorption is commonly recognized because the accumulation of the substance in a surface area, and activated carbon operates since its porous framework gives inner surfaces in which concentrate on molecules could possibly be retained. For powdered activated carbon for decolorization, values which include iodine range, specific surface space, and methylene blue value help explain the material’s basic adsorption tendency and the kind of pore framework it may well favor. nonetheless, the coloured substances in a very liquid are definitely the adsorbates, although the carbon is the adsorbent; a practical match is determined by both sides of that relationship. the next range can show additional out there adsorption potential less than a given check issue, but the actual pigment mixture may not resemble the test molecule, focus, or liquid environment behind that range. This is certainly why “higher capability” should be examine as a material description rather then a hard and fast end result warranty. A carbon with powerful micropore growth may accomplish very well for more compact organic and natural shade bodies, whilst larger shade compounds may need less difficult diffusion as a result of mesopores and macropores prior to they attain useful adsorption web-sites. Liquid composition also adjustments the Level of competition all over Those people websites: dissolved organics, salts, oils, residual reactants, or procedure additives can occupy pores, block entry, or alter pigment solubility. whenever a powdered activated carbon supplier lists particle size, surface space, and adsorption values, These information aid slender the specialized dialogue, but they cannot substitute sample screening, color measurement, or generation-line verification for a certain liquid.
pH, temperature, Make contact with time, mixing, and filtration kind one particular issue ladder
The main reason decolorization final results vary is usually that method situations impact several techniques at once: pigment sort in the liquid, molecular motion towards the carbon floor, adsorption equilibrium, and remaining removing of spent carbon. dealing with pH or temperature as isolated figures can be deceptive. In practice, a process issue may well increase one particular Portion of the chain while producing trouble somewhere else, including quicker diffusion but more challenging filtration, or better pigment adsorption but amplified competition from other dissolved substances.
•pH changes pigment demand, solubility, and surface interaction. several colour bodies and natural and organic impurities respond to acidity or alkalinity. A shift in pH can transform no matter if a pigment stays dissolved, associates with other molecules, or ways the carbon area in a very variety that is less complicated or more challenging to adsorb.
•Temperature affects diffusion pace and adsorption stability. Warmer liquids generally cut down viscosity and enable molecules move more quickly, which could make improvements to contact in certain techniques. simultaneously, adsorption equilibria can shift with temperature, so higher temperature shouldn't be assumed to boost pigment elimination in each and every liquid.
•Get hold of time and mixing make your mind up whether or not the carbon area is definitely utilised. good powdered activated carbon can offer strong Get in touch with probable, but provided that it disperses well sufficient and stays in contact long adequate for concentrate on molecules to reach obtainable pores. below-mixing could leave adsorption web-sites unused, although excessive home assumptions can overstate simple effectiveness.
•Filtration establishes if the decolorized liquid might be separated cleanly. just after adsorption, the spent carbon and captured coloration bodies needs to be faraway from the liquid. Filter media, cake habits, particle fineness, viscosity, and suspended solids can all have an effect on clarity, throughput, and regardless of whether residual wonderful particles remain.
This ladder also points out why the same decolorization activated carbon may appear fantastic in one liquid and only average in One more. If your pigment is presently in the kind that may diffuse into the pore community, and When the liquid is not difficult to mix and filter, the carbon has a better likelihood to express its adsorption opportunity. If the liquid includes competing organics, substantial viscosity, unstable pH, or tricky solids, the identical carbon specification might not produce the exact same visible coloration reduction. For B2B audience comparing activated carbon maker data, the sensible lesson is to connect Every single mentioned parameter to your procedure condition instead of rank materials by just one quantity alone.

Conclusion
Powdered activated carbon decolorization is greatest understood as an interaction amongst content Attributes and process ailments. Iodine value, floor place, methylene blue worth, particle dimension, pH assortment, and temperature range all issue, but none of them by itself predicts every single pigment removal result. pH can change the condition of coloration bodies, temperature can modify diffusion and equilibrium, Make contact with time and mixing influence the amount carbon area is employed, and filtration decides whether or not the taken care of liquid may be separated cleanly. When reading a powdered activated carbon provider, decolorization activated carbon provider, or activated carbon maker website page, utilize the specs as technological clues and keep on interpreting them from the genuine liquid, cure goal, and separation method.
FAQ
Q:Why can the identical powdered activated carbon give different decolorization results in different liquids?
A:exactly the same carbon can deal with various pigment molecules, dissolved organics, pH ranges, viscosity, salts, temperatures, and filtration read more conditions. These factors have an impact on pigment sort, diffusion into pores, competition for adsorption web-sites, Get in touch with performance, and ultimate carbon elimination, Hence the obvious decolorization consequence can differ even though the carbon specification is unchanged.
Q:Does a better iodine price guarantee much better pigment removal in every approach condition?
A:No. Iodine price can be a beneficial adsorption-connected specification, but it doesn't characterize all pigment sizes, all pore-accessibility disorders, or all liquid chemistries. Some shade bodies may well depend extra on mesopore obtain, mixing, contact time, pH, competing impurities, or filtration habits than on iodine worth on your own.
Q:How need to pH and temperature ranges on the powdered activated carbon supplier website page be interpreted?
A:they must be read through as method-condition clues rather then fastened overall performance promises. A outlined pH or temperature vary can propose where the fabric is usually mentioned or anticipated to work, but actual dosage, Call time, color reduction, and filtration high quality nonetheless rely upon the particular liquid and will be verified by way of testing or specialized evaluate.
